CLARiTY Error Messages
Table 6-5 provides the faults and warnings related to job design.
For complete list of faults and warnings refer to Integra Operator Manual.
Error
No.
Error Description
Remedial Actions
Status
E5005
SlotSensorDetection
‘Dancer Arm Fault
-
The dancer arm
has
failed to return
to its
home
position.
Ensure the dancer arm is free to move.
This
fault may be caused by an obstructed
dancer arm, or a faulty dancer arm home
position sensor. You can view the sensor
state at Tools > Diagnostics > Printhead >
Inputs.
If the problem persists, please call your
local
service representative. The machine will
not
run until this fault is resolved. Once
resolved
and ready, press the ‘Clear button
below.
Fault
E5008
IntegraMotor
VoltsOutOfRange
‘Label Drive Fault’ -
The
label drive motor
power
safety system
has
detected that the
motor
volts are
outside the
working
range.
Power the machine off and on to see if
the
problem persists. This error can also be
caused by a faulty motor, a faulty main PCB
or a faulty power supply.
Please call your local service
representative
for further support. The
machine will not run
until this fault is
resolved.
Fault
